Advanced Monitoring Techniques



Using innovative tracking methods in Google Analytics can dramatically boost the depth and granularity of data collected for more thorough analysis and insights. One such technique is event tracking, which allows for the monitoring of specific interactions on a website, like clicks on buttons, downloads of documents, or video clip sights. By executing occasion tracking, services can get a deeper understanding of individual habits and interaction with their on the internet web content.


Additionally, custom-made measurements and metrics provide a method to tailor Google Analytics to specific organization demands. Personalized measurements permit for the production of brand-new data points, such as individual duties or consumer sectors, while personalized metrics enable the monitoring of distinct efficiency indicators, like profits per customer or typical order worth.


In addition, the usage of Google Tag Supervisor can enhance the execution of monitoring codes and tags across an internet site, making it much easier to take care of and release sophisticated monitoring configurations. By harnessing these innovative tracking methods, services can open useful understandings and maximize their online approaches for much better decision-making.

Data Testing Evasion



When dealing with huge quantities of data in Google Analytics, conquering data tasting is crucial to make certain exact understandings are obtained for informed decision-making. Information tasting takes place when Google Analytics approximates patterns in information as opposed to evaluating the complete dataset, possibly resulting in skewed results. To stay clear of information tasting, one effective strategy is to reduce the day array being examined. By concentrating on much shorter timespan, the possibility of encountering sampled data declines, providing a more precise depiction of user actions. Furthermore, making use of Google Analytics 360, the costs version of the system, can assist reduce tasting as it permits greater data limits before tasting begins. Implementing filters to tighten down the data being evaluated can additionally aid in preventing sampling problems. By taking these proactive actions to lessen data tasting, businesses can remove extra precise insights from Google Analytics, bring about much better decision-making and improved overall performance.
